medications (e.g., corticosteroids) Management Maintain skin and mucous membrane integrity Minimize handling and transfer of patients to prevent further epithelial damage or rupture of bullae Safe airway management Mucous membranes of the respiratory tract and pleura may be involved Ulcers in the nose, oropharynx, trachea, and bronchi increase the risk of hematemesis Avoid manipulation and trauma to the oral, tracheal, and laryngeal mucosa (lesions are often present) Avoid desquamation of the skin on the face during mask pre-oxygenation Difficulties getting venous access, application of monitors and anesthesia face masks, airways, laryngoscopy, and intubation Establish access over areas of normal epidermis Use invasive BP monitoring Use one smaller than the standard size for laryngeal mask airways Adhere to strict aseptic precautions at all stages (immune-compromised state and susceptibility to respiratory infection) Induction with etomidate or ketamine could provide better hemodynamic stability when compared to propofol or thiopental Non-depolarizing muscle relaxants are often used if muscle relaxation is necessary to avoid succinylcholine and the associated risk of hyperkalemia Fluid and electrolyte replacement Avoid hypothermia OR temperature 28C Warm i.v
